An investigation into staff perceptions concerning the legitimacy of anti-doping policy implementation in Regional Anti-Doping Organisations
Project description
Summary: The purpose of this study is to examine the practical challenges faced by the World Anti-Doping Agency (WADA) in harmonizing drug testing practices across National Anti-Doping Organizations (NADOs) by investigating the perceptions of Regional Anti-Doping Organizations (RADOs) responsible for supporting new anti-doping regimes. The goal is to gain insights into the difficulties encountered by RADOs in implementing anti-doping policies and contributing to global harmonization.
